Think about where you'll put your barbeque when identifying the size you'll require. Before you begin searching for a BBQ, determine how much space you have available. Undoubtedly, your budget plan will certainly also establish what dimension and sort of barbeque you can get. As soon as you understand just how much room you're collaborating with, take into consideration the measurements of the BBQ several websites as well as shops provide these online so you can conveniently compare them.

this is the standard choice, and lots of people delight in the smokey flavor supplied by a charcoal barbeque. Cooking on a charcoal BBQ, on the other hand, is time consuming given that it takes a long time to warm up. It's also tough to preserve a constant temperature, as well as it's not as very easy to clean as the other alternatives.

a built-in is the most effective barbeque if you have an outside kitchen area or entertainment location where you wish to permanently fit a BARBEQUE. This will certainly need to be connected to your homes gas supply and also becomes an irreversible feature that can not be relocated. The other factor to consider is the rate as they are typically costly to integrate in.

Here is are some guidelines to help you choose: the tiniest of the barbecues, this size is best for a family of 2-4. this is one of the most preferred size in Australia as it is functional as well as spacious. A 4 burner BBQ is finest for a household of 4-6. a 6 burner barbecue is the biggest alternative offered.

The flavour produced will certainly typically depend on the kind of Barbeque being utilized. A gas Barbeque often tends to offer a far better flavour than an electric one because when it comes to managing the burner, gas is a lot more responsive to temperature changes so you can obtain a far better sear.

An electrical BBQ is a really convenient option, however they supply induction heat from an aspect that normally powers on and off intermittently. Due to this, it can be tough to get an excellent sear on the food. With a gas burner, you can use constant high warm at the temperature level you want, this gives you far more control over just how your cooking ends up.

Some gas barbeques even use variable warm options that enable you to cook at various temperature levels at the exact same time. One of the essential attributes of a great BBQ is having top quality grill plates. Grills are readily available in various products yet they are frequently made from either: stainless steel is a common material used for grills, it is simple to tidy and also sturdy.
